Nienhagen is a producing conventional oil field located onshore Germany and is operated by ExxonMobil Production Deutschland. The field is located in block Celle and Nienhagen.
Field participation details
The field is owned by Shell, LetterOne Holdings, Exxon Mobil and BASF.
Production from Nienhagen
The Nienhagen conventional oil field recovered 80.31% of its total recoverable reserves, with peak production in 2002. The peak production was approximately 0.13 thousand bpd of crude oil and condensate. Based on economic assumptions, production will continue until the field reaches its economic limit in 2048.
Remaining recoverable reserves
The field is expected to recover 0.17 Mmboe, comprised of 0.17 Mmbbl of crude oil & condensate.
